.NET框架是微软推出的一个强大的开发平台,它支持多种编程语言,如C#、VB.NET等。MySQL是一款流行的开源关系型数据库管理系统。将.NET应用与MySQL数据库连接起来,可以方便地实现数据的存储和检索。以下是连接.NET应用与MySQL数据库的五大步骤:
步骤一:安装MySQL数据库
- 访问MySQL官方网站下载MySQL数据库。
- 根据操作系统选择合适的安装包进行安装。
- 安装过程中,设置root用户密码,并创建数据库名称和数据表。
步骤二:安装MySQL .NET驱动程序
- 访问MySQL官方网站下载MySQL .NET驱动程序。
- 解压下载的文件,找到
mysql-x.x.x-nunit20.dll和mysql-x.x.x-nunit20.pdb文件。 - 将这两个文件复制到.NET项目的bin目录下。
步骤三:配置数据库连接字符串
- 打开.NET项目,在App.config文件中添加以下配置:
<connectionStrings>
<add name="MySQLConnectionString"
providerName="MySql.Data.MySqlClient"
connectionString="server=localhost;port=3306;database=your_database;user=root;password=your_password;"/>
</connectionStrings>
- 将
server、port、database、user和password替换为实际的数据库连接信息。
步骤四:编写连接数据库的代码
- 在.NET项目中,添加以下引用:
using System.Data;
using MySql.Data.MySqlClient;
- 编写连接数据库的代码:
string connectionString = "server=localhost;port=3306;database=your_database;user=root;password=your_password;";
MySqlConnection connection = new MySqlConnection(connectionString);
try
{
connection.Open();
Console.WriteLine("连接成功!");
}
catch (MySqlException ex)
{
Console.WriteLine("连接失败:" + ex.Message);
}
finally
{
connection.Close();
}
步骤五:执行数据库操作
- 在连接成功后,可以执行各种数据库操作,如查询、插入、更新和删除等。
- 以下是一个示例代码,用于查询数据库中的数据:
string query = "SELECT * FROM your_table";
MySqlCommand command = new MySqlCommand(query, connection);
MySqlDataReader reader = command.ExecuteReader();
while (reader.Read())
{
Console.WriteLine(reader["column_name"].ToString());
}
reader.Close();
通过以上五个步骤,您就可以轻松地将.NET应用与MySQL数据库连接起来,并进行各种数据库操作。在实际开发过程中,您可以根据需求修改数据库连接字符串和操作代码。